Location Details

The Sekhe village is situated in the Lower Subansiri district with district code number 255. Pistana is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 01699. Ziro - Ii is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0073. Yachuli is the Sub-district headquarter of this village and it is situated 45 kilometres away from this village. The district headquarters' name is Ziro - I and as per distance concern it is 64 kilometres from the Sekhe village.

Nearest Towns / Cities

Hapoli is the nearest statutory town of the village Sekhe, which is 64 kilometres away from the village. Hapoli is the nearest statutory town of this village lies within the state of Arunachal Pradesh and situated with the distance 64 kilometres away from village.

Sekhe Households and Populations



The total number of households in Sekhe village are 33. It rely on the total population of 191 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 106 of the village Sekhe and the total female population number is 85.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
